It seems to me that the main problem is that
comp.lang.python is too big to follow. So why
not split it? I don't know the right subgroups,
but if (say) comp.lang.python.language focusses
on the core language, it might enable people to
start reading it again.
I asked this twice on c.l.p, one year ago and
two years ago, and the answer was always "the
traffic is too low". I used to subscribe to
the NeXTSteap groups, and splitting worked
really well there.
